They did a re run of this earlier show. She has not seen him in prison, but he has written to her. Is a psychopathic killer capable of caring for a family (genuinely) while also being a sadistic killer?
Probably to some degree, but I doubt it's the type of love a normal person would feel for their family. Having a wife and kids helped him maintain a totally normal appearing façade, while he committed his crimes. He actually comforted his wife and daughter by telling them they had nothing to fear from BTK, and he was the only person on the planet who could truthfully make that statement.
If he truly & deeply cared for his family, he would have stopped killing and never been caught and no one but him would have ever known. No, I don't think he was capable of true love. It would have to have outweighed his sexual fantasies, and that didn't happen.
